Lorimer Avenue is a residential street with 91 addresses.
It ranks as the 322nd largest and 181st most expensive of the 332 streets in the GU6 area. The dominant property type is a modern house built after 1980.
The street contains a total of 91 properties: 52 houses and 39 flats.
Sale prices range from £234,057 for 2 bedroom leasehold flats (548 ft2) to £818,883 for 4 bedroom freehold houses with a garden (1,797 ft2) .
Monthly rental prices range from £1,307 pcm for 2 bed flats to £2,931 pcm for 4 bed houses.
The gross rental yield is between 4.1% and 6.7%.
The average value per square foot is £483.
The last sale on Lorimer Avenue sold for £720,000 on 10th December 2025. Since then prices are up an average of 0.1%.
The current average value in the street is £518,043.
The Lorimer Avenue Sales Market has increased by 11.3% over the last 10 years.

The recent census recorded whether a resident owned or rented their home.
In the area around Lorimer Avenue, Cranleigh, GU6, 60.8% of property is privately owned outright and 19.6% is privately rented.

The recent census recorded the highest level of education achieved by residents in the local area.
In the area around Lorimer Avenue, Cranleigh, GU6, 16.0% of residents are recorded as possessing school level qualifications and 48.5% as possessing degree level qualifications.

The most recent census in 2021 recorded the age of all UK residents.
In the area around Lorimer Avenue, Cranleigh, GU6, the average age was 44.3 and the most common age was 17.
